It didn’t take long for Notre Dame coach Mike Brey to fill the first of two staff openings.
Less than 48 hours after two assistant coaches left the program, Brey has made former Irish captain Ryan Humphrey (2000-02) his first hire, according to a tweet by his former teammate, Jordan Cornette.
Notre Dame has not confirmed the hire.
Humphrey, who spent the last two seasons as director of player development at Northwestern, was the 19th overall pick in the 2002 NBA draft. He played in the NBA for three seasons. Humphrey averaged 18.9 points, 10.9 rebounds and earned first-team All-Big East honors in his final season with the Irish.
